'National Milk Day' is celebrated on November 26 to mark the birth anniversary of India's most successful dairy entrepreneur Dr Varghese Kurien, the founder of dairy firm Amul.
Kurien played a key role in formation of Amul, which broke the local trade cartel 65 years ago, paving way for the dairy co-operative sector to flourish in Gujarat. He served Gujarat Cooperative Milk Marketing Federation (GCMMF) from 1973 to 2006.
India is the largest milk producer in the world. In July, minister of state for agriculture, Krishna Raj informed Lok Sabha that India's milk production is estimated to have increased by 6.6 percent to 176.35 million tonnes during the last financial year. She said the projected milk production by 2021-22 is 254.5 million tonnes as per the vision 2022 document.
In the case of availability of the dairy products, the per capita milk available pan India is 355 grams per day. Punjab, Rajasthan, Haryana and Gujarat are among the top states which have the most milk available.
